    Provide well-designed bicycle facilities to ensure not just a bare minimum level of safety, but also provide a desirable environment that is comfortable, enriching and encourages people to prioritize biking as the primary mode of transportation.

Design intersections with bicycle facilities to reduce conflicts between bicyclists and other users (vehicles and vulnerable road users) by heightening visibility, denoting a clear right-of-way, and ensuring that the various users are aware of each other. Continue marked bicycle facilities at intersections (up to crosswalk), and, where needed, place the bike lane pocket between the right turn lane and the rightmost through lane.
